The Campaign

The Flight 93 National Memorial Capital Campaign has been launched nationally and internationally, seeking to raise $30 million from philanthropic individuals, corporations and foundations to enable the construction of the Flight 93 National Memorial. Generous gifts ranging from the pennies of school children, to major commitments from corporations and foundations, have already helped to jump-start the campaign on a local, regional, and national level.

Campaign Divisions  
Launch Phase (completed): Key Pittsburgh Funders
Local Phase: Somerset, Ligonier, Johnstown, and Pittsburgh
Regional Phase: Pennsylvania, Texas, California, and DC
National Phase:  
   Pacesetter Gifts: Pledges/Gifts: $1,000,000 plus
   Major Gifts: Pledges/Gifts: $100,000 up to, but not including, $1,000,000
   Special Gifts: Pledges/Gifts: $10,000 up to, but not including, $100,000
   Public Gifts:  Pledges/Gifts: up to, but not including, $10,000
